Abstract
This paper suggests first-order and second-order generalized zero equalities and constructs a new flexible Lyapunov-Krasovskii functional with more state terms. Also, by applying various zero equalities, improved stability criteria of linear systems with interval time varying delays are developed. Using Wirtinger-based integral inequality, Jensen inequality and a lower bound lemma, the time derivative of the Lyapunov-Krasovskii functional is bounded by the combinations of various state terms including not only integral terms but also their interval-normalized versions, which contributes to make the stability criteria less conservative. Numerical examples show the improved performance of the criteria in terms of maximum delay bounds. (C) 2016 Elsevier Inc. All rights reserved.
